Psalms 86:1 KJV (King James Version)
Bow down thine ear, O LORD, hear me: For I am poor and needy.
Psalms 86:1 NASB1995 (New American Standard Bible - NASB 1995)
Incline Your ear, O LORD, and answer me; For I am afflicted and needy.
Psalms 86:1 NCV (New Century Version)
LORD, listen to me and answer me. I am poor and helpless.
Psalms 86:1 ASV (American Standard Version)
Bow down thine ear, O Jehovah, and answer me; For I am poor and needy.
Psalms 86:1 NIV (New International Version)
Hear me, LORD, and answer me, for I am poor and needy.
Psalms 86:1 NKJV (New King James Version)
Bow down Your ear, O LORD, hear me; For I am poor and needy.
Psalms 86:1 AMP (Amplified Bible)
Incline Your ear, O LORD, and answer me, For I am distressed and needy [I long for Your help].
Psalms 86:1 NLT (New Living Translation)
Bend down, O LORD, and hear my prayer; answer me, for I need your help.
Psalms 86:1 TPT (The Passion Translation)
Lord, bend down to listen to my prayer. I am in deep trouble. I’m broken and humbled, and I desperately need your help.
Psalms 86:1 ESV (English Standard Version 2025)
Incline your ear, O LORD, and answer me, for I am poor and needy.
